MATTER OF CARINCI v. FRIEDMAN


301 A.D.2d 600 (2003)

753 N.Y.S.2d 858

In the Matter of LEONARD CARINCI, Respondent, v. SARI M. FRIEDMAN,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

Decided January 21, 2003.


Ordered that on the court's own motion, Leonard Carinci, the Preliminary Executor of the Estate of Peggy Carinci, also known as Peggy Gazawi-Carinci, is substituted as the respondent in the place and stead of the deceased Peggy Gazawi; and it is further,

Ordered that the judgment is affirmed; and it is further,

Ordered that one bill of costs is awarded to the respondent.

Contrary to the appellant's contention, the arbitration award was properly confirmed...
